1. The Shift Toward Hybrid Support Models
The future of customer service isn’t human versus machine – it’s human and machine. Hybrid support models blend AI efficiency with human empathy, creating a seamless customer journey.
AI handles repetitive, high-volume tasks, such as password resets, order tracking, and FAQs, freeing human agents to tackle complex, emotionally charged, or revenue-critical issues.
For example, AI chatbots can resolve 80% of Tier 1 inquiries instantly, while live agents step in for nuanced troubleshooting or escalations. This balance ensures speed without sacrificing the personal touch customers crave.
2. Practical Benefits of AI in Support Operations
- Speed & Accuracy – AI interprets customer intent in seconds, routes inquiries to the right channel, and even predicts issues before they arise.
- Cost Efficiency – Automating Tier 1 tasks reduces headcount needs and labor costs. One SaaS company slashed support costs by 40% while improving customer satisfaction.
- Data-Driven Insights – AI analyzes behavioral trends, identifies recurring pain points, and provides actionable metrics, like First Contact Resolution (FCR) and Net Promoter Score (NPS), to refine strategies.
3. Why AI Alone Isn’t Enough
While AI excels at efficiency, it can’t replicate human judgment. Complex billing disputes, empathetic crisis support, or technical deep-dives require skilled agents.
The magic lies in synergy: AI streamlines workflows, while humans deliver creativity and emotional intelligence. Together, they boost performance metrics, such as CSAT, by 20% or more, as seen in the energy and tech sector case studies.
